Как да деактивирате dep в windows 10 и под него: основни методи

Всички потребители, които работят с операционни системи Windows на последните поколения, като се започне от седмата модификация, вероятно поне веднъж в живот с стартиране на програма сте получили съобщение, че приложението е било затворено от системата, тъй като е осъществен достъп до някакъв адрес в паметта. Специална услуга DEP, разработена навремето за предотвратяване на вирусни атаки както на ниво операционна система, така и на ниво първична система BIOS/UEFI, е отговорна за такова поведение на компютъра. Предлагаме ви ръководство за деактивиране на услугата DEP в Windows 10 и в системите по-долу. Но нека първо да разберем какво представлява тази услуга, защо е необходима и защо причинява грешки.

Какво представлява услугата DEP и защо трябва да бъде деактивирана?

Технологията, която стои зад тази услуга, е сравнително нова. Първоначално е проектиран да поддържа процесори на Intel и AMD. Това се нарича XD за Intel (Изпълнението е забранено), за AMD - като NX (Не се изпълнява). Съкращението на основната услуга означава Data Execution Prevention (предотвратяване на изпълнението на данни). Без да се задълбочавате в техническите подробности, можете да си го представите като инструмент за проверка и блокиране на определени адреси на оперативната памет, ако тези, които са маркирани като неизпълними, официално носят изпълними вирусни кодове. С други думи, тази технология позволява да се предотврати изпълнението им, дори след като са проникнали в оперативната памет със заредени собствени модули.

Грешка, причинена от услугата DEP

Подобна "грижа" за компютърната сигурност често може да изиграе жестока шега с потребителите, тъй като услугата може лесно да блокира изпълнението на всяка програма, която изглежда подозрителна.

Как в Windows да деактивирате DEP, за да се отървете от грешка в определена услуга или програма?

Въпреки факта, че технологията първоначално работи на ниво основна система, самата фамилия операционни системи Windows, отскоро има специален системен компонент, представен само от тази услуга. Що се отнася до това как да деактивирате DEP в Windows 10 и по-ранните операционни системи (до версия 7 включително), за обикновените потребители са достъпни няколко основни метода, но най-простият начин е да използвате собствените инструменти на системата.

Първо, отидете в свойствата на компютъра си, след това отидете на разширени системни настройки, след което щракнете върху бутона за настройки на скоростта.

Деактивиране на DEP за избрани програми

Сега, в раздела с името на оригиналната услуга, вместо първия елемент, активиран по подразбиране, маркирайте втория, щракнете върху бутона, за да добавите непрекъснато причиняващото грешки приложение като изпълним файл в списъка и след това запазете инсталираните опции.

Какво да направите, ако дадено приложение не е включено в белия списък?

Изглежда достатъчно просто, но понякога добавянето на блокирано приложение в списъка за деактивиране може да се окаже проблем и системата незабавно издава известие, че избраното действие не може да бъде изпълнено.

Антивирусна програма KVRT

В такава ситуация (въпреки официалния си произход) инсталирано приложение) е силно препоръчително да го проверите незабавно за вируси, но не трябва да използвате вътрешен скенер, а независим преносим инструмент като KVRT или Dr. Web CureIt. Напълно възможно е заплахата да бъде открита и неутрализирана, след което програмата да не бъде включена в списъка. Ако все още е необходимо да се добави в списъка с изключения, добавете приложението, въпреки че вече не е абсолютно необходимо.

Как да деактивирате DEP в Windows 7, 8, 10 чрез команден ред?

Горната методология е проста, но не винаги дава желания резултат. Ето защо отделно разглеждаме как да деактивираме DEP в Windows 10 и по-долу, като използваме инструментите на командния ред, които изглеждат по-ефективни в сравнение със стандартните инструменти.

Деактивиране на DEP в командния ред

Изпълнете командния ред като администратор и след това изпълнете командата, показана на изображението по-горе. Този метод има предимството да деактивира услугата за всички изпълними компоненти, а не само под формата на EXE файлове на системни услуги и потребителски програми. След изпълнение на командата е задължително рестартиране на системата.

Деактивиране на услугата в регистъра

Сега нека видим как да деактивираме DEP в Windows 10 с помощта на регистъра. Стъпките тук изглеждат малко по-сложни, но резултатът е най-ефективен.

Деактивиране на DEP за програми в регистъра

В редактора (regedit) разширете клона HKLM и след това преминете в него нагоре по дървото на дяловете до директорията Layers, както е показано на снимката по-горе. В работната област отдясно за всяко приложение, което искате да деактивирате DEP услугата, създайте нов параметър на реда, наречете го с пълния път до EXE файла и в полето за стойност въведете DisableNXShowUI. Както при предишната процедура, трябва да извършите пълно рестартиране на компютъра.

Възможно ли е да деактивирате услугата?

Възможно ли е да деактивирате услугата в BIOS? Как да деактивирате DEP в Windows 10, разбирамвъведете. Струва си да се отбележи, че използването на системни инструменти може да няма никакъв ефект, ако BIOS/UEFI е активиран. Някои потребители твърдят, че не може да бъде деактивирана в основните системи. Най-дълбоката заблуда! Деактивиране на DEP Windows 10 в BIOS възможно е, ако знаете къде да търсите тези настройки. Проблемът е, че няма име на услугата в първичните системи, но можете да намерите опции, свързани с основната технология. Тези опции обикновено са обозначени като Изпълнение на Изключване на бит, Защита на паметта без изпълнение,Изпълнението се забранява Функция Или нещо подобно.

Деактивиране на DEP в BIOS/UEFI

За този параметър просто задайте стойност Disable (Деактивиране) И запазете промените при излизане, след което ще последва автоматично рестартиране.

Забележка: услугата ще бъде деактивирана като цяло, а не само за една избрана програма.

Статии по темата